'An absolute blinder' - Fans erupt following sensational Sari van Veenendaal performance

There are plenty of Arsenal links in today's World Cup final between the Netherlands and the United States, with three players from the Gunners in action.

Vivianne Miedema, Danielle van de Donk and Jill Roord were all chasing a victory in order to return to North London for the new season with a World Cup medal around their neck - but it was a former Arsenal player who had the biggest say in the first half.

Sari van Veenendaal, who is searching for a new club after leaving Arsenal at the end the campaign following victory in the Women's Super League, made a number of sensational saves to keep the United States at bay.

The defending champions and favourites to retain their crown, the USA enjoyed the lion's share of possession in Lyon during the opening 45 minutes but, despite creating numerous opportunities, could not find a way past the experienced stopper.

One particular highlight was a superb double save to prevent Sam Mewis and golden-boot chasing Alex Morgan from opening the scoring, as she kept the European champions in the match.

Her displays did not go unnoticed on social media, as many fans flocked to laud praise upon the former Arsenal stopper following her display.
